1
Which of the following types of solder is best for radio and electronic use?
Select one:
a. Silver solder
b. Rosin-core solder
c. Aluminum solder
d. Acid-core solder
b
2
A series connected C −R circuit is suddenly connected to a d.c. source of V
volts. Which of the statements is false?
Select one:
a. The initial current flowing is given by V/R
b. The current grows exponentially
c. The final value of the current is zero
d. The time constant of the circuit is given by RC
b
3
Why is a pull-up resistor needed when connecting TTL logic to CMOS logic?
Select one:
a. To decrease the output LOW voltage
b. To increase the output HIGH voltage
c. To decrease the output HIGH voltage
d. To increase the output LOW voltage
b
4
A nickel-cadmium cell has an operating voltage of about ____ volts.
Select one:
a. 1.25
b. 1.5
c. 2.1
d. 1.4
a
5
According to Gauss' law for magnetism, magnetic field lines:
Select one:
a. start at south poles and end at north poles b. form closed loops
c. start at both north and south poles and end at infinity
d. start at north poles and end at south poles
b
6
Which of the following instruments would be best for checking a TTL logic
circuit?
Select one:
a. Continuity tester
b. DMM
c. Logic probe
d. VOM
c
7
What is an L-network?
Select one:
a. A network consisting of an inductor and a capacitor.
b. A "lossy" network.
c. A low power Wi-Fi RF network connection. d. A network formed by joining two low pass filters.
a
8
When examining the frequency response curve of an RC low-pass filer, it
can be seen that the rate of roll-off well above the cutoff frequency is
_______.
Select one:
a. 20 dB/decade
b. 6 dB/octave
c. Both 6 dB/octave and 20 dB/decade
d. 6 dB/decade
c
9
Iron, rather than copper, is used in the core of transformers because iron:
Select one:
a. Has a greater resistivity.
b. Can withstand a higher temperature.
c. Makes a good permanent magnet.
d. Has a very high permeability.
d
10
When a pulsating dc voltage is applied as an input to the primary of a
transformer, the output from the secondary contains:
Select one:
a. a stepped up or down version of pulsating dc voltage.
b. only the steady dc component of the input signal
c. only the ac component of the input signal.
d. None of the choices.
c
11
In normal operation, a p-n-p collector connected in common-base
configuration has:
Select one:
a. the collector at a lower potential than the emitter
b. the base at a higher potential than the emitter
c. the emitter at a lower potential than the base
d. the collector at a higher potential than the emitte
a
12
In normal operation, the junctions of an n-p-n transistor are:
Select one:
a. base-collector forward biased and base emitter reverse biased
b. base emitter forward biased and base collector reverse biased
c. both reverse biased
d. both forward biased
b
13
What waveform would appear on the voltage outputs at the collectors of
an astable multivibrator, common-emitter stage?
Select one:
a. Sawtooth wave.
b. Half-wave pulses.
c. Sine wave.
d. Square wave.
d
14
Which of the following statements is false?
Select one:
a. The national standard phase sequence for a three-phase supply is
R, Y, B.
b. For the same power, loads connected in delta have a higher line
voltage and a smaller line current than loads connected in star.
c. AC may be distributed using a single-phase system with two wires, a
three-phase system with three wires or a three-phase system with four
wires.
d. When using the two-wattmeter method of power measurement the
power factor is unity when the wattmeter readings are the same
b
15
When the frequency of the oscillator in a series RLC circuit is doubled:
Select one:
a. the capacitive reactance is doubled
b. the capacitive reactance is halved
c. the current amplitude is doubled
d. the impedance is doubled
b
16
An RLC circuit has a sinusoidal source of emf. The average rate at which
the source supplies energy is 5 nW. This must also be:
Select one:
a. The average rate at which energy is dissipated in the resistor.
b. The average rate at which energy is stored in the inductor.
c. Twice the average rate at which energy is stored in the capacitor.
d. The average rate at which energy is stored in the capacitor.
a
17
In an SCR, anode current flows over a narrow region near the gate during
______.
Select one:
a. more than μsec
b. rise time tr and spread time tp
c. about 10 µsec
d. delay time d
c
18
In a UJT, intrinsic standoff ratio, η, is typically:
Select one:
a. 0.2
b. 0.99
c. 0.4
d. 0.7
d
19
For a relay, the holding current is defined as:
Select one:
a. the maximum current the relay contacts can handle.
b. the minimum amount of relay coil current required to keep a relay
energized.
c. the maximum current required to operate relay.
d. the minimum amount of relay coil current required to energize a
relay.
b
20
If the secondary current in a step-down transformer increases, the primary
current will ____.
Select one:
a. drop a little
b. decrease
c. increase
d. not change
c
21
What is the purpose of a coupling capacitor?
Select one:
a. It decreases the resonant frequency of the circuit.
b. It blocks direct current and passes alternating current.
c. It blocks alternating current and passes direct current.
d. It increases the resonant frequency of the circuit.
b
22
A series connected C −R circuit is suddenly connected to a d.c. source of V
volts. Which of the statements is false?
Select one:
a. The initial voltage drop across the resistor is IR, where I is the steadystate current
b. The initial capacitor voltage is zero
c. The capacitor voltage is equal to the voltage drop across the resistor
d. The voltage drop across the resistor decays exponentially
c
23
Using the polar coordinate system, what visual representation would you
get of a voltage in a sinewave circuit?
Select one:
a. To graphically represent the AC and DC component.
b. To display the data on an XY chart.
c. The plot shows the magnitude and phase angle.
d. To show the reactance which is present.
c
24
What determines the visible color radiated by an LED junction?
Select one:
a. The amount of voltage across the device.
b. The materials used to construct the device.
c. The amount of current through the device.
d. The color of a lens in an eyepiece.
b
25
What is the voltage range considered to be a valid logic high input in a TTL
device operating at 5.0 volts?
Select one:
a. 1.5 to 3.0 volts.
b. 1.0 to 1.5 volts.
c. 5.2 to 34.8 volts
d. 2.0 to 5.5 volts
d
